About the role
We are excited to invite applications to join our trust as a Locum Consultant in General Medicine, with specialist interest. The job will include joining a small team of general medical consultants to look after patients on a 20-cubicled ward as well as medical outliers.
Successful candidates will join a growing team looking to transform the way we care for general medical patients.
We are committed to multi-professional development and there are myriad opportunities to develop the department within your area of interest. Areas particularly encouraged are same day emergency and enhanced level and remote care, ultrasound Imaging and echocardiography, education, research and development and quality improvement. We support part-time and flexible working patterns and are embedding self-rostering to maximize autonomy and well-being.
The Royal Surrey Hospital, is one of the few hospitals in the country to be rated 'Outstanding' by the Care Quality Commission (CQC).
The general physician(s) will be responsible for providing consultant cover for the medical patients on Guildford Ward and outlying patients on two specialist wards and the emergency department. The key duties and responsibilities of the post will be: Clinical and administrative responsibility for patients on Guildford Ward. Early and appropriate clinical decision making for emergency admissions. Supervision of medical admissions through the Guildford ward and on the medical take. Promoting flow through from the Emergency Department. Recruitment, supervision and training of junior medical staff and allied health professionals working in the units. Ensuring that resuscitation and end of life care issues are appropriately and sensitively managed. Development of clinical pathwaysDelivery of clinical audits and quality improvement relevant to the needs of the department. Recruitment and active involvement with clinical trials in both units. Participate on the GIM on call rota.
